
VP of Clinical Objectives (Antwain Allen: MSN, BS, FNP-C)
Antwain is a Board-Certified Family Nurse Practitioner through the American Academy of Nurse Practitioners. He received a bachelor’s degree in Exercise Science from Western Michigan University, a second bachelor’s degree in nursing from William Jewell College and a master’s degree in Nursing with a focus in Family Medicine from Kaplan University. Antwain is from the Southside of Chicago, where he was born and raised. His foundation for wanting to help and serve others started at a young age. He was raised most of his childhood by a single mother, who at times worked three jobs to provide. Observing his parent’s drive, set the tone for his personal and professional drive. Antwain’s home-life consists of his three beautiful children and one furry child. They are the fuel that he needs daily to keep moving forward.
The sense of creating joy and producing growth in others, led Antwain to a career in health care. Antwain started his health care career over 15 years ago. He has served in many different medical positions within hospitals and outpatient centers. Antwain specializes in emergency medicine, caring for patients with many different types of illnesses. Antwain has experience in large hospitals and small community hospitals. Antwain currently practices as a certified nurse practitioner in emergency medicine.
